The 5.11 Tactical Men's Taclite Pro Pants combine durable, triple-stitched polyester-cotton ripstop fabric with a Teflon finish for stain and moisture resistance. Featuring a gusseted inseam and action waistband, these pants offer superior flexibility and comfort. With 8 specialized cargo pockets designed for quick access and secure storage, they are engineered for professionals who demand rugged performance and reliability in every setting.

Most comfortable and functional pants I've owned!
I grew up wearing jeans. I like the feeling of "rugged and durable, but comfortable at the same time". I don't like wearing sweats or softer material pants because my legs feel... unprotected? That may sound crazy, but I've gotten so used to feeling something substantial on my legs and it gives a sense of security (yes, possibly false security and it's purely psychological). Jeans, however, can be heavy and restrictive. I always look for "relaxed fit" or "loose fit", and that seems to help. Over the past few years I've discovered that products designed for military and law enforcement use tend to be high quality and work very well for their intended purpose. I'm not in the military or a cop, and I'm sure those who ARE might laugh at what I just said, because they probably use some gear that was poorly designed or has other issues. My experience with tactical clothing and gear for civilian use has been very positive. So I thought I'd give these pants a try as a stubstitute for the carpenter jeans I normally wear for everything that isn't work or church. Town, hiking, around the house, etc. I couldn't be more pleased! These pants fit perfectly when I ordered my normal jean size. They are very comfortable and more flexible than jeans. I really like they way they feel. I don't think they are baggy, but I do prefer looser fitting pants. Because they are 60% polyester 40% cotton, they don't breath quite as well as 100% cotton, but this blend also makes them more durable and resistant to spills. I got caught in the rain wearing them, and when I got inside, I literally slapped the water off them leaving them mostly dry. They aren't waterproof if you really get soaked, obviously. I ordered a pair of Blackhawk Lightweight Tactical pants at the same time for comparison. The Blackhawk feel heavier and have more pockets. I probably prefer the 5.11 because of the lighter, more comfortable feel and more colors available. I like "charcoal" and "coyote brown" better than regular "khaki tan". Both are great pants and I put them right back on as soon as I wash them. One thing to note, the 5.11 Taclite Pro have an gathered material, elastic waistband, while the Blackhawk Lightweight Tactical have a smooth, expanding waistband (internal elastic bands and sliding tabs, instead of gathered material) which might be more comfortable, but again, heavier feeling. So bottom line, I use them for a wide range activities from shopping to weekend hiking and photography. They are handy for just about any activity. Are they worth paying a little more than jeans? In my opinion, definitely!

Wear daily indoors and out, and will wear nothing else now!!
OK when you work at a police academy and teach firearms at an outdoor range in Florida, the pants you use have to be tough, and able to be both warm and cool. These fit that bill! I wear these daily as my training uniform, I put them through the ringer and they hold up great and are very well made and comfortable. I will not wear any other pants for work. I never have to iron them, they come out of the dry and hang to get a nice clean line in them. I have been wearing these for at least 10 years or more now. I only have to buy new ones every three years or so, and for pants to last 3 years with me is a accomplishment! As you can see in the photo, I put them through a bit of rough stuff now and then, yet they look just as good now as when I bought them. I highly recommend these pants for anyone looking for some good, nice looking, comfortable, rugged pants. With the right shirt these can even be rather dressy, but mine are used as part of my daily uniform for work. While I have had to buy shirts almost every year, these outlast my shirts. I like the added fabric at the bottom of the front pockets for knife clips. This keeps the pants pocket edges from fraying from the clips. Plenty of pockets for almost anything, the front left pocket is my spare magazine pocket, and the right front slit pocket is great for knifes, extra fabric in the knees and the crotch is cut to give free range of movement. If you want a really durable, well built, long lasting pant for range or work, these are the ones! UPDATE! 09/01/2018 - I bought these pants 3 tears ago, and I am still using them, and they are still completely good to go! Amazing for me as I wear them every day. I am getting ready to order a couple more since I have stained a couple of pair with oil from gun cleaning, and also from some really nasty mud, I was rolling around in. Even then, they held up well and stains would not have been a problem, but I let them sit instead of washing them. I still recommend them and will continue to wear them every day!
